Transaction 99cf701446e70d734b51dc19d1853ee40f9f9e50129cf01acb21e32349d2dbfd

13 Input
2 Outputs
  • 99cf701446e70d734b51dc19d1853ee40f9f9e50129cf01acb21e32349d2dbfd:0
  • value  1000014
    address  1Dru81NDr68wswRcvpTDP9hvPJEEq4HVdz
  • 99cf701446e70d734b51dc19d1853ee40f9f9e50129cf01acb21e32349d2dbfd:1
  • value  12546032
    address  195qaR8RmzgMEkcccnQAvqih2XNsPKv7u7